As the government announces that £4.7bn of the money that would have been spent on HS2 is to be reallocated to northern English councils so they can spend it on something more useful, Stop HS2's Joe Rukin points out that Stop HS2 has said right from the start that we should be investing in the transport infrastructure that people use every day rather than a fast train for fat cats.

As the Public Accounts Committee publishes a highly critical report about HS2 saying it's very poor value for money, Manchester's mayor Andy Burnham (Labour) and West Midlands mayor Andy Street (Conservative) propose an alternative railway between Birmingham and Manchester, finally admitting that you don’t need the expense of the HS2 to increase capacity. A mandated but unnecessary track speed of 400km/h meant that HS2 would destroy anything in its path. This drone video shows how HS2 has ripped right through Burton Green, Warwickshire (without any station).

HS2 Ltd's chair tells MPs that HS2 trains to Manchester will be slower than the current Pendolinos and have fewer seats. Stop HS2 Chair Joe Rukin tells Nick Ferrari that the project "has been a disaster from start to finish". LBC, 11th Jan 2024
